I have had a search around including through this thread, can anyone provide instructions on how to turn off the galloping sound upon start-up (see video). It doesn’t make a whole lot of logical sense to me but this is what I hear currently:

Door open seatbelt off = 4 chimes
Door open seatbelt on = 5 chimes 🤔
Door closed seatbelt off = 4 chimes
Door closed seatbelt on = 1 chime



Also, is it normal that each time I set a change in FORScan I lose a lot of my settings (e.g. cluster theme reverts to base, 24hr clock changes to 12hr, pre-collision assist switches all nannies back on, MyColour resets to base, alarm system “ask on exit” reverts to on, tyre pressure changes to kPa) but it remembers others (e.g. quiet start schedule, audible feedback off (in “Locks”), connectivity features (disabled data sharing), touchscreen beep off, instrument cluster).

@BuckeyeBOSS if you’ve read through this thread then you’ll have a good idea of which are the common changes but I have done ESE off, and I’m testing out continuous gear display at the moment (enabled today) but not sure I like it tbh - it’s additional info on the screen that I don’t really need when not in manual mode, and given the size of the gear number and it constantly changing in automatic I find it distracting. The other thing I did was enable remote rev, which depending on your market may be disabled as standard but is there in FORScan.

The other thing I would really like to do but can’t find any instructions on how to do it is replace two of the soft keys on the centre console for track features. First the heated steering wheel because here in the desert I’m never going to need it! There is also a max rear window demister in both soft and physical buttons 🤯 neither of which I will need either. Confused further that one of those wasn’t a max AC button 🤷

Anyone know if it is possible to reprogram the soft or physical keys? Or even add more options to the Favourites button menu?
